If pain persists for more than a few days, is severe, or interferes with daily activities, you should consult a specialist for evaluation.

If your child experiences persistent pain, limping, or swelling after sports activities, or has sustained a suspected growth plate or overuse injury, it's important to consult a pediatric orthopedic specialist to ensure proper diagnosis and age-appropriate care.
